Kondi to Depart Sweet Briar
Sweet Briar College Head Field Hockey Coach Isabella Kondi will leave after one season to take a position at Vermont State University, Castleton. Her departure is driven by a desire to balance her coaching career with family commitments. During her brief tenure, she fostered strong relationships with student-athletes, cultivating a competitive and supportive team dynamic. Highlights from the season include a memorable overtime win against Meredith College, showcasing the team's resilience. Kondi expressed gratitude for her experience at Sweet Briar, emphasizing the importance of both her professional growth and family priorities.
By the Numbers- Kondi coached the Sweet Briar field hockey team for one season.
- She led the team to a notable overtime victory against Meredith College.
- Sweet Briar College is now in search of a new head coach for the field hockey program.
- The Vixens' program has a rich history of over 100 years, aiming to continue its competitive legacy.
